I don't see much point in pursuing this document, unfortunately. This is
because:

   1. I don't think there is value of this document unless it precisely
   defines what a LAP is.
   2. I suspect the working group will not be able to reach consensus on
   any definition of LAP. This is because there will be participants that
   claim that the prefix length for address assignment is already clearly
   defined in RFC 4291 as being "64 bits long", and there will be participants
   to whom that definition is unacceptable.

The document says the goal of the document is not to rehash those opinions,
but it does look very much like a rehash to me.
